Diagnostics

Most diagnostic measures come down to confirming the fact of the disease and identifying a specific allergen. They include an examination by an allergist and a number of laboratory tests. Here are some of them:

  • Blood test for immunoglobulin E. The most reliable method for detecting an allergic disease. The fact is that most of the symptoms of allergies are similar to acute respiratory infections and other diseases. And the analysis of the content of IgE antibodies allows you to give an accurate answer to this question;
  • Blood tests for specific antibodies. This study is a variation of the immunoglobulin E test, but now doctors are interested not only in the total number of antibodies, but also in the concentration of antibodies of a particular type. Thanks to this, a specific allergen can be identified;
  • Application (skin) tests. A proven and effective method that allows you to unambiguously answer the question: “Can a patient have an allergy?”. Here, samples of the allergen are applied to the patient's skin, after which the skin is scratched, and doctors observe the body's reaction. This method is accurate and quite safe. Although it takes some time.
  • provocative tests. A very accurate method that allows you to give a conclusion with a probability of almost 100%. A side effect is its increased danger to the patient, because a concentrated dose of a potential allergen is introduced into his body.

But regardless of the chosen method, studies should be carried out by specialists, and the results should be analyzed by allergists. Otherwise, there is a high risk of data distortion and misdiagnosis.

Treatment

Most treatment measures are aimed at combating the effects of allergies. Fortunately, modern pharmaceuticals offer a wide range of medicines. Moreover, drugs are constantly being improved, getting rid of side effects.

Antihistamines

The most popular are antihistamine drugs .
They counteract the production of histamine, an active substance produced by the body in response to an allergen attack. In other words, these drugs attack the very essence of allergies. Third-generation antihistamines are considered the safest and most effective. They do not cause drowsiness and provide a long-term effect. True, the price of such drugs is somewhat higher.

Hormonal and steroid drugs

"Heavy artillery" in the fight against allergies are drugs based on corticosteroids and other hormonal drugs. They effectively fight edema, inflammation and shortness of breath, but have a number of contraindications and side effects. Therefore, their use is possible only as prescribed by a doctor, with strict adherence to the regimen.

Allergen-Specific Immunotherapy

Allergen-specific immunotherapy, also known as ASIT, stands apart in the list of allergy treatments.
The fact is that this therapy does not fight the symptoms, but the disease itself. With ASIT, the patient is regularly injected with small doses of the allergen, forcing the body to "get used" to it. The treatment process takes up to a year or more. But the efficiency is over 85%.
